Hint: Game editor:
------------------
Open the game via the start menu. Note that under the icon used to launch the game
is an editor. Click on it. When the editor starts, select "File", "Load Database",
"Server_db", "People", "Edit", then "Create Person". You can also do this with team,
stadium, etc. However when done using "Team"", the league you want will not work.

If you are in a good background club(like Man Utd and Real Madrid)and you need a world class
player like Ronaldinho and Eto'o,do the following process:
Add a manager at Barcelona.Select Ronaldinho and you will see'Discipline player'.Select
'Discipline Player for no Reason'.Continue this for 4-5 times and then mutualy terminate
his contract.Then add a manager at Man Utd or Chelsea and you can easily buy the player
